The Shanghai Incident: Detailed Chronology and Response

On October 23, during evening hours in Shanghai’s Xuhui District, a Li Auto Mega experienced catastrophic thermal runaway while in motion. Eyewitness videos show the vehicle’s underside initiating the combustion sequence, with flames engulfing the entire structure within ten seconds. Multiple explosions originated from the battery compartment, suggesting intense energy release from the power system. Despite the violence of the event, the vehicle’s doors remained operational, enabling both occupants to evacuate without injury.

Immediate Corporate and Regulatory Reaction

Li Auto (理想汽车) responded within hours, confirming through official statements that “the doors opened smoothly during the incident, allowing the driver and all passengers to safely exit the vehicle.” The company dispatched specialized teams to coordinate with Shanghai fire authorities, pledging full cooperation with the official investigation. Li Auto Mega Product Profile and Market Positioning

As Li Auto’s inaugural pure electric offering, the Mega model represents a strategic pivot from the company’s successful extended-range electric vehicles. Launched on March 1, 2024, with a starting price of 559,800 RMB, the Mega targets China’s premium family transportation segment. Current variants include the 2025 Ultra Smart Driving Edition and 2025 Home Special Edition, priced between 529,800 RMB and 559,800 RMB. This positioning places Li Auto in direct competition with established premium EVs from rivals like NIO (蔚来) and Xpeng (小鹏汽车).

Battery Technology Specifications

The Mega utilizes the jointly developed Qilin battery (麒麟电池) from CATL (宁德时代) and Li Auto, employing ternary lithium (NMC) chemistry with cells manufactured exclusively by CATL. This partnership represents a significant technological collaboration within China’s EV ecosystem, combining CATL’s battery leadership with Li Auto’s vehicle integration expertise. The Qilin battery architecture promises enhanced energy density and faster charging capabilities, though the Shanghai incident raises questions about thermal management under fault conditions.

Industry technical reviews indicate the Qilin battery incorporates multiple safety redundancies, including advanced battery management systems and compartmentalized cell isolation. However, the violent nature of the Shanghai fire suggests possible cascading failure within the module array. Electric Vehicle Battery Safety Landscape in China

The Li Auto Mega safety incident occurs against a backdrop of intensifying focus on EV battery reliability across Chinese markets. Industry data indicates approximately 60% of electric vehicle fires originate from battery thermal runaway, often triggered by internal short circuits, overcharging, or manufacturing defects. China’s Ministry of Industry and Information Technology (工业和信息化部) has progressively tightened safety standards, though implementation consistency varies across manufacturers and regions.

Regulatory Framework and Industry Standards

China’s “Energy-Saving and New Energy Vehicle Technology Roadmap 3.0” (节能与新能源汽车路线图3.0) explicitly targets a transportation ecosystem toward “zero accidents, zero casualties, and high efficiency.” This policy direction emphasizes intelligent connected vehicle safety as a national priority, with particular emphasis on battery management systems and thermal containment. The roadmap mandates increasingly rigorous testing protocols, including nail penetration tests, overcharge protection, and thermal propagation resistance requirements.

Recent regulatory updates from the Standardization Administration of China (国家标准化管理委员会) have expanded compulsory safety verification for high-voltage battery systems. Manufacturers must now demonstrate containment of thermal events for至少5 minutes to facilitate occupant evacuation, a standard that appears validated by the Li Auto Mega’s door functionality during the Shanghai incident.
